**Mail Room Relocation — Access Notes**

From the first of next month, the mail room at Ashgrove Plaza moves from the ground floor of Tower One to Level B1 of Tower Two, next to the loading dock. Facilities desk staff will handle sorting and courier handoffs from the new location. The old room will be decommissioned and its reader removed. Access to the new room is via the keypad by the roller shutter until badge permissions are migrated. The interim door code is below.

badge for fawip-kafof: bdg-TMT-0

## Authentication

Stormfan is the fan-out worker that pushes weather alerts from Gustline to regional subscriber queues. Every push authenticates against the internal Gustline gateway; no anonymous mode exists. Rotation happens monthly via the Vaultwren job, so don't pin old values in configs. Staging and prod use separate credentials — mixing them silently drops alerts, which bit us during the Harbrook incident. The worker reads the key below at boot.

API key for yahig-tadup: kto7_ubizbYm

Attendees: R. Dastrel (chair), P. Yumiko, H. Grevan, sales leads.

The meeting addressed the licensing dispute with Caldrith Software over embedded use of the Lumera toolkit in our Fieldmark product. Counsel reported that Caldrith rejected our interpretation of the redistribution clause and has proposed arbitration in Vellport. Sales leads were instructed to pause new Fieldmark enterprise quotes pending guidance. A revised fee proposal will be circulated by Friday. Our negotiating position rests on the plan noted below.

management briefing: The renewal with Zoraelax Group closes at $10 million a year, 15 percent below the last contract. Project Ralael slips by six weeks because of the audit delay.